I don't see Andersson being made available, nor any future 1st round picks in a deal for Evander Kane.

First and foremost he is a left shot left winger. Not a need whatsoever.
Secondly, Micheal Ferland is starting to put to rest any notion that another top six option is necessary at this point.
Thirdly, Kane is a player who is an upcoming UFA that has not eclipsed the 43 point mark in 5 seasons. Yes, he has had a phenomenal start to the year but trading for him now would be buying high, which is never a smart thing to do.
Lastly, Kane's potential off ice / character issues are a legitimate concern.

I just don't see the need or the want from our end to move valuable future pieces for such an asset.
